Hembree Heating and Air Named a Mobile Chamber Small Business of the Year Finalist
MOBILE, Ala. — The Mobile Chamber has named Hembree Heating and Air a 2025 Small Business of the Year finalist, recognizing the company’s long-standing commitment to integrity, community service and excellence in the HVAC industry.
Founded in 1969 by Walter Donald Hembree Sr., the business began as a small, family-run operation with Walter handling service calls and his wife answering phones from their home. When Walter suffered a debilitating back injury, his son, Don, purchased the company at only 17 years old. Driven to improve safety and efficiency in the industry, Don expanded the business tenfold before the age of 27.
Today, Hembree Heating and Air is under the leadership of Don’s son, Josh, who initially pursued a career in law before returning home to continue the family legacy. While practicing law in Montgomery, Josh learned that Don was considering retirement and selling the company. Feeling a deep pull to preserve what his family had built, Josh transitioned into the business, combining his legal and business skills with a passion for serving the community. Under his leadership, the company has grown sixfold over the past five years.
The company offers a full range of HVAC services, including installation, maintenance and indoor air quality solutions, while maintaining a strong “people first” culture. Leaders credit this philosophy with creating a family atmosphere within the business, which translates into stronger customer relationships and better service for the Mobile Bay region.
“Hembree Heating and Air’s primary responsibility is to serve our community, families and create life-long relationships by providing the best solutions to our customers’ HVAC needs,” said General Manager Josh Hembree. “We invest in our people, and always put people above profit. We strive daily to be known as the employer of choice in our industry by constantly growing a culture founded on collaboration, empowerment and accountability that fundamentally believes in going above and beyond whatever we are doing and making our community a better place.”
In 2024, Hembree Heating and Air donated more than $100,000 in free or discounted HVAC systems, ductwork and repairs to local families and organizations in need. The company also sponsors numerous youth sports teams, schools, churches and community groups. Many contributions are made quietly and without publicity, in line with the company’s belief that “to whom much is given, much is required.”
Hembree’s values are summed up in its “We Believe” statements, which guide every aspect of operations. These principles include supporting families, giving back generously, standing behind their work, using the best technology, providing clear communication and offering outstanding customer service.
“We have always believed in doing the right thing, putting our people, customers and community above profit,” Hembree said. “That commitment has shaped our business for three generations, and we are honored to be recognized by the Mobile Chamber as a Small Business of the Year finalist.”
